Julia St. LouisRogers Elementary School first grade teacher Julia St. Louis is leading televised lessons for students as part of Nine Network’s “Teaching in Room 9” series.

The Nine Network is producing two hours of literacy and math instruction for children in preschool through fourth grade each weekday. St. Louis’s first lesson was a math lesson for preschool through first grade students. 

In addition to providing her lessons for the Nine Network's viewership, St. Louis is also modeling persistence and growth mindset, components of the Mehlville School District Portrait of a Graduate.

“Making my first lesson was a little nerve-wracking,” St. Louis said. “I love teaching, but as my students have come to learn, I can often make mistakes, lose items in the middle of a lesson, and drop things. Filming for TV was an added extra pressure. After a few bad takes, I realized I am always going to make these mistakes and I have to go with it, it is a part of who I am as a teacher.”

The lessons air each day on Nine Network from 12:30-2:30 p.m.
